On Wed, 26 Jan 2022 23:22:24 +0100
Fabrice Fontaine <fontaine.fabrice@gmail.com> wrote:
> Indeed, this is true but atk and libnice are meson packages.
> For autotools packages, commit
> 8dda79970661090f202e1f20e5982ba53fdaeb95 updated
> Makefile.introspection.
Correct, I also looked into these :-)
> poppler is a cmake-package and I thought that the suggested approach
> is the simplest, less invasive and quickest approach. Upstream is also
> ok for this patch.
Yeah, maybe it's the most pragmatic solution. It just feels annoying
that we have to teach "all" users of GOI where the GIR files are
located.
